Oil Change Interval
So BMW states 15K mile oil changes.
My Bentley book states 7500 mile oil changes. As a reference, my wife's MB C300 uses full synthetic Mobil 1 and states 10K mile oil changes. What interval do you guys recommend? I'm thinking split the difference and do 10K changes. I have a 2006 330xi that is out of warranty with 114K on it. Thanks. |

its not a waste. It all gets recycled into new oil or fuel oil. either way someone is going to use either that recycled oil or fuel oil... when crude is $90+/bbl, used oil is not wasted...
and on the subject of 'waste of money' changing at 3k, oil is cheap as chips. A rebuilt N52 would run $3k+ just for the engine (no labor). Thats a shite load of oil. If you have ever rebuilt a few engines, you know you can spot the one that had long change intervals regardless of the brand of oil...

I'd say 5-7.5k miles depending on your driving habits. I do a lot of spirited driving, so I try to do it around 5k. If you're the one to drive more conservatively, 7.5k miles should be fine. As everyone's said, 10k is pushing it as it will just result in a shorter life cycle of the engine, and BMW's "recommended" 15k is just nuts!!
